Автоматизация и боты

 Помощь      Поиск      Пользователи
Сайт Кибор     Программируемый кликер Кибор     Видео обучение     Заказать бот

 Страниц (1): [1]   

> Описание: Доработка format. Поиск пикселей определенного цвета. Доработка всплывающего меню.
Kibor
Отправлено: 02 Ноября, 2013 - 19:38:45
Post Id



Администратор
Эксперт


Покинул форум
Сообщений всего: 8094
Дата рег-ции: Март 2013  
Откуда: Одесса
Репутация: 355




Добавлена функция поиска координат пикселей определенного цвета: findcolor. Описание findcolor.

//////////////////////////////////////////////

Доработана функция format.
Так как в Кибор нельзя напрямую приравнивать char к int и int к char введены функции форматирования.

formatic - возвращает char чисового значения в параметре:

char a = formatic(78);

formatci - возвращает int char'а значения в параметре:

int a = formatci('b');

///////////////////////////////////////////////

Доработка меню на правой кнопке:
В меню ПЕРЕМЕННЫЕ добавлена структура указателя win

///////////////////////////////////////////////

Добавление в функции key, keydown и keyup возможность в виде параметра указывать не только char и string, но и код клавиши в int:

key (65) аналогично key ('A');

////////////////////////////////////////////////////

Внутренняя доработка некоторых функций...
 
 Top
Overdose5530
Отправлено: 22 Августа, 2018 - 17:39:14
Post Id



Пользователь
Наблюдатель


Покинул форум
Сообщений всего: 47
Дата рег-ции: Авг. 2017  
Репутация: 0




codhex(formatci(getcontrol(EDIT_3)), #a444[0]); //

findmemorymask (-1, #poisk[0], 1157, #adr[0], 0, #mask[0], 100, prc)
{
writememory(#a444[0], 20, adr[0]+88, prc); //
}

Здравствуйте. Надо заменить от 1й до 10букв никнейма. Пока что получается заменить 1ю букву перезаписывает 1й байт и все. я могу создать 10 EDIT и вписывать по 1й букве но этот вариант не очень. Как правильно нашу строку EDIT_3 например с 10 букв конвертировать в Hex и перезаписать нужный мне адрес?
 
 Top
neba2101
Отправлено: 02 Сентября, 2019 - 21:28:50
Post Id



Пользователь
Мастер


Покинул форум
Сообщений всего: 142
Дата рег-ции: Февр. 2017  
Репутация: 4




int a=formatci('a');
int a_B=formatci('A');
messagebox("a - " + format(a) + " A - " + format(a_B));

Здравствуйте!
formatci так и должен возвращать разные значения маленькой и большой буквы?

(Отредактировано автором: 02 Сентября, 2019 - 21:30:01)

 
 Top
Kibor
Отправлено: 02 Сентября, 2019 - 21:43:21
Post Id



Администратор
Эксперт


Покинул форум
Сообщений всего: 8094
Дата рег-ции: Март 2013  
Откуда: Одесса
Репутация: 355




Это разные символы. Если бы у них было одно значение это был бы один символ.
Не путайте код символа и код клавиши.
 
 Top
007wan
Отправлено: 03 Сентября, 2019 - 07:08:37
Post Id



Пользователь
Эксперт


Покинул форум
Сообщений всего: 1838
Дата рег-ции: Март 2017  
Репутация: -2




Блин, а чо новое и что старое? Вроде все это видел.
 
 Top
Страниц (1): [1]
Сейчас эту тему просматривают: 1 (гостей: 1, зарегистрированных: 0)
« О программе Кибор »


Все гости форума могут просматривать этот раздел.
Только администраторы и модераторы мог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 




Powered by